100 most recent commits (all timestamps are UTC) |
FreshPorts has everything you want to know about FreeBSD software, ports, packages,
applications, whatever term you want to use.
Yesterday's Commits | Quarterly Branch
|
Thursday, 14 Nov 2024
|
09:22 Hiroki Tagato (tagattie)
security/vuxml: document electron31 multiple vulnerabilities
Obtained from: https://github.com/electron/electron/releases/tag/v31.7.4
ca2ab31 |
08:55 Nicola Vitale (nivit)
net-im/linux-discord: Update to 0.0.74
59ba1f5 |
08:47 Robert Clausecker (fuz) 2024Q4
net-mgmt/rate: fix build on 15-CURRENT
- link with -lutil to grab ftime() on 15-CURRENT. This is harmless on
older FreeBSD
- while we are at it, install binary using INSTALL_PROGRAM so it is
stripped
Approved by: portmgr (build fix blanket)
MFH: 2024Q4
(cherry picked from commit 76b0011589e1ec4eb2ebf5544e47e4ea7d630a99)
da04050 |
08:47 Robert Clausecker (fuz) 2024Q4
sysutils/ods2: unbreak fetch, fix build on 15-CURRENT, define license
- turn static REINPLACE_CMD into patch file
- define LICENSE
- host distfile that has gone away locally (port seems import enough
to warrant keeping it)
- obey CC
- link with -lutil to get ftime() on 15-CURRENT, this is harmless on
older versions of FreeBSD
Approved by: portmgr (build fix, infrastructure blanket)
MFH: 2024Q4
(cherry picked from commit 3a14c653f469248012926e196386c487c51fb7ce)
b6d1709 |
08:47 Robert Clausecker (fuz) 2024Q4
astro/openuniverse: fix build on FreeBSD 15-CURRENT
ftime() is now provided by libutil; link -lutil in addition to -lcompat
to get it; this is harmless on older FreeBSD.
While we are at it, define LICENSE and fix USE_GL stage-qa warnings.
MFH: 2024Q4
(cherry picked from commit c3dde4ea970725e330129e79b3130457f08a1459)
8c761ec |
08:43 Robert Clausecker (fuz) Author: Jose Maldonado aka Yukiteru
x11-wm/picom: update to v12.5
** New in v12.4
* Improvements
Better workaround for a NVIDIA qurik, fix high CPU usage when screen is off
(#1265)
Avoid using xrender convolution in all cases, should improve shadow performance
for most users. (#1349)
* Bug fixes
Fix leak of saved window images.
* Build fixes
Fix build on arm32 (#1355)
** New in v12.5
* Bug fixes
Fix assertion failure when running with some window managers (e.g. qtile) and no
window is focused (#1384)
PR: 282708
ce330f1 |
08:43 Robert Clausecker (fuz) Author: Martin Filla
security/sniffglue: update to 0.16.1
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/kpcyrd/sniffglue/releases
PR: 282729
1e70bc4 |
08:43 Robert Clausecker (fuz) Author: Thibault Payet
security/u2f-devd: Add Token2 T2F2-Bio2 and Feitian Biopass Pro
PR: 282715
Signed-off-by: Thibault Payet <[email protected]>
d3c40cd |
08:43 Robert Clausecker (fuz) Author: mew14930xvi
games/sokoban: install xsokoban's screens
- maintainership goes to submitter
PR: 281881
2b9e7c1 |
08:43 Robert Clausecker (fuz) Author: Sergei Vyshenski
textproc/p5-Text-CSV_XS: Update to 1.57
- Update 1.56 -> 1.57
ChangeLog: https://metacpan.org/dist/Text-CSV_XS/changes
PR: 282721
e9e9fe7 |
08:43 Robert Clausecker (fuz)
converters/simdutf: update to 5.6.1
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/simdutf/simdutf/releases/tag/v5.6.1
f77ddec |
08:43 Robert Clausecker (fuz)
- filesystems/ztop 0.2.3_9
Display ZFS dataset I/O in real time
- sysutils/ztop 0.2.3_9
Display ZFS dataset I/O in real time
- MOVED
- filesystems/Makefile
sysutils/ztop: move to new category filesystems
Forgot this one in my initial commit.
Approved by: portmgr (infrastructure blanket)
778c14a
08:43 Robert Clausecker (fuz) Author: Stefan Schlosser
- emulators/flycast 2.4
Multi-platform Sega Dreamcast emulator
emulators/flycast: New Port: Multi-platform Sega Dreamcast emulator
Flycast is a multi-platform Sega Dreamcast, Naomi, Naomi 2, and Atomiswave
emulator derived from reicast.
WWW: https://github.com/flyinghead/flycast
PR: 282691
dd40da6
08:43 Robert Clausecker (fuz) Author: Stefan Schlosser
- devel/libchdr g20241111
Standalone library for reading MAME CHDv1-v5 formats
devel/libchdr: New port: Standalone library for reading MAME CHDv1-v5 formats
libchdr is a standalone library for reading MAME's CHDv1-v5 formats.
The code is based off of MAME's old C codebase which read up to CHDv4 with
OS-dependent features removed, and CHDv5 support backported from MAME's current
C++ codebase.
WWW: https://github.com/rtissera/libchdr
PR: 282692
c66fa58
08:43 Robert Clausecker (fuz) Author: Krešimir Jozić
- devel/wasmer 5.0.1
WebAssembly Runtime supporting WASIX, WASI and Emscripten
devel/wasmer: Update to 5.0.1
Changelog:
https://github.com/wasmerio/wasmer/blob/main/CHANGELOG.md#501---06112024
PR: 282615
bb7efe7 |
08:43 Robert Clausecker (fuz) Author: Robert William Vesterman
textproc/ripgrep-all: depends on textproc/ripgrep
textproc/ripgrep-all will exit with a failure message when invoked if
ripgrep is not also installed. This commit changes the Makefile so that
textproc/ripgrep is listed as a runtime dependency, and therefore will
be automatically built and installed along with textproc/ripgrep-all.
PR: 282151
Approved by: [email protected] (maintainer timeout)
2346138 |
08:43 Robert Clausecker (fuz) Author: Lexi Winter
- databases/prometheus-postgres-exporter 0.16.0
PostgreSQL metric exporter for Prometheus
databases/prometheus-postgres-exporter: update to 0.16.0
- the maintainer address is updated
- a new pkg-message is added to document the breaking change in the log
format when upgrading the package.
upstream release notes:
---o<---
BREAKING CHANGES:
The logging system has been replaced with log/slog from the stdlib. This
change is being made across the prometheus ecosystem. The logging output
has changed, but the messages and levels remain the same. The ts label
for the timestamp has bewen replaced with time, the accuracy is less,
and the timezone is not forced to UTC. The caller field has been replaced
by the source field, which now includes the full path to the source file.
The level field now exposes the log level in capital letters.
* [CHANGE] Replace logging system #1073
* [ENHANCEMENT] Add save_wal_size and wal_status to replication_slot collector
#1027
* [ENHANCEMENT] Add roles collector and connection limit metrics to database
collector #997
* [ENHANCEMENT] Excluded databases log messgae is now info level #1003
* [ENHANCEMENT] Add active_time to stat_database collector #961
* [ENHANCEMENT] Add slot_type label to replication_slot collector #960
* [BUGFIX] Fix walreceiver collectore when no repmgr #1086
* [BUGFIX] Remove logging errors on replicas #1048
* [BUGFIX] Fix active_time query on postgres>=14 #1045
---o<---
PR: 255100
a3b2656
08:43 Robert Clausecker (fuz) Author: King John
- www/geckodriver 0.35.0
Proxy for using WebDriver clients with Gecko-based browsers
www/geckodriver: update to v0.35.0
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/mozilla/geckodriver/blob/release/CHANGES.md
PR: 282666
Approved by: [email protected] (maintainer)
1c89946 |
08:43 Robert Clausecker (fuz) Author: King John
- www/selenium 4.26.0
Selenium Standalone Server, allows browser testing
www/selenium: update 4.8.3 -> 4.26.0
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/SeleniumHQ/selenium/blob/trunk/java/CHANGELOG#L355
PR: 282706
Approved by: [email protected] (maintainer)
8834e9f |
08:43 Robert Clausecker (fuz) Author: David Hummel
graphics/mapnik: Update to 4.0.3
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/mapnik/mapnik/releases/tag/v4.0.2
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/mapnik/mapnik/releases/tag/v4.0.3
PR: 282707
a1ce438 |
08:43 Robert Clausecker (fuz) Author: Jesús Daniel Colmenares Oviedo
archivers/py-zipstream-ng: Update to 1.8.0
ChangeLog: https://github.com/pR0Ps/zipstream-ng/blob/v1.8.0/CHANGELOG.md
PR: 282684
46217be |
08:43 Robert Clausecker (fuz) Author: Jesús Daniel Colmenares Oviedo
www/py-searxng-devel: Update to 20241108
ChangeLog:
https://github.com/searxng/searxng/commits/2fbf15eccbbc3af70f8b93257c9a39d26603f097/
PR: 282662
4c05108 |
08:43 Robert Clausecker (fuz) Author: Jesús Daniel Colmenares Oviedo
irc/py-sopel-help: Update to 0.5.2
ChangeLog: https://github.com/sopel-irc/sopel-help/releases/tag/0.5.2
PR: 282664
7e6ec16 |
08:43 Robert Clausecker (fuz) Author: Jesús Daniel Colmenares Oviedo
textproc/py-extract-msg: Update to 0.52.0
ChangeLog:
https://github.com/TeamMsgExtractor/msg-extractor/blob/v0.52.0/CHANGELOG.md
PR: 282682
60177a3 |
08:43 Robert Clausecker (fuz) Author: Jesús Daniel Colmenares Oviedo
sysutils/appjail: Update to 3.5.0
ChangeLog: https://github.com/DtxdF/AppJail/releases/v3.5.0
* Clarified: more about cloned_interfaces option, resolv.conf(5) and
appjail.conf(5).
* Added: missing check for when priority is not defined.
PR: 282660
9e12535 |
08:43 Robert Clausecker (fuz) Author: Jesús Daniel Colmenares Oviedo
graphics/vhs: Update to 0.8.0
ChangeLog: https://github.com/charmbracelet/vhs/releases/tag/v0.8.0
PR: 255061
ea27aad |
08:43 Robert Clausecker (fuz) Author: Peter Laursen
www/osrm-backend: fix build post LLVM 19 import
After the base system compiler was updated to Clang 19, the port failed
to build. (The specific bug is in its version of sol2 included in this
port). To fix this, I've added a patch that uses an older version of
Clang on FreeBSD-CURRENT after the update to clang 19 was applied.
It's a bit heavy-handed, but at least it gets the port building again on
CURRENT until I can find some time to make a more permanent fix for the
library.
PR: 282641
dd668bb |
08:43 Robert Clausecker (fuz) Author: Nikita Druba
net-im/openfire: update to 4.9.1
Changelog:
https://download.igniterealtime.org/openfire/docs/4.9.1/changelog.html
PR: 282552
c35c1e1 |
08:43 Robert Clausecker (fuz) Author: Stefan Schlosser
emulators/ares: update to 141
Release notes: https://ares-emu.net/news/ares-v141-released
PR: 282548
b47f423 |
08:43 Robert Clausecker (fuz) Author: Stefan Schlosser
devel/librashader: update to 0.5.1
Changes:
https://github.com/SnowflakePowered/librashader/releases/tag/librashader-v0.5.0
https://github.com/SnowflakePowered/librashader/releases/tag/librashader-v0.5.1
Version 0.5.0 bumps the ABI to 2, and is thus ABI-incompatible with versions of
librashader prior to 0.5.0. Trying to load this version of librashader will fail
if the application only supports ABI 1.
Upstream's librashader-build-script doesn't do more than to compile the package
librashader-capi and to move the resulting files around. Therefore the port uses
the standard do-build target from the ports framework by setting CARGO_FEATURES
and CARGO_BUILD_ARGS appropriately instead.
This standardization also allows us to drop the DEBUG port option. Generating a
debug build is now controlled by setting WITH_DEBUG, see also Mk/Uses/cargo.mk.
The port now only compiles the OpenGL and Vulkan runtimes by specifying the
appropriate CARGO_FEATURES. This excludes compiling the unneeded Metal and
DirectX runtimes.
PR: 282547
MFH: no (ABI break)
e290c5e |
08:43 Robert Clausecker (fuz) Author: Paul Floyd
devel/valgrind-devel: update to 3.25.0.g20241104
Changes wrt. valgrind-3.24.0:
494327 Crash when running Helgrind built with #define TRACE_PTH_FNS 1
494337 All threaded applications cause still holding lock errors
495488 Add FreeBSD getrlimitusage syscall wrapper
PR: 282544
d4b38a2 |
08:43 Robert Clausecker (fuz) Author: Paul Floyd
devel/valgrind: update to 3.24.0
Change log
202770 open fd at exit --log-socket=127.0.0.1:1500 with --track-fds=yes
276780 An instruction in fftw (Fast Fourier Transform) is unhandled by
valgrind: vex x86->IR: unhandled instruction bytes:
0x66 0xF 0x3A 0x2
311655 --log-file=FILE leads to apparent fd leak
317127 Fedora18/x86_64 --sanity-level=3 : aspacem segment mismatch
337388 fcntl works on Valgrind's own file descriptors
377966 arm64 unhandled instruction dc zva392146 aarch64: unhandled
instruction 0xD5380001 (MRS rT, midr_el1)
391148 Unhandled AVX instruction vmovq %xmm9,%xmm1
392146 aarch64: unhandled instruction 0xD5380001 (MRS rT, midr_el1)
412377 SIGILL on cache flushes on arm64
417572 vex amd64->IR: unhandled instruction bytes: 0xC5 0x79 0xD6 0xED 0xC5
440180 s390x: Failed assertion in disassembler
444781 MIPS: wrong syscall numbers used
447989 Support Armv8.2 SHA-512 instructions
445235 Java/Ada/D demangling is probably broken
453044 gbserver_tests failures in aarch64
479661 Valgrind leaks file descriptors
486180 [Valgrind][MIPS] 'VexGuestArchState' has no member named
'guest_IP_AT_SYSCALL'
486293 memccpy false positives
486569 linux inotify_init syscall wrapper missing POST entry in syscall_table
487439 SIGILL in JDK11, JDK17
487993 Alignment error when using Eigen with Valgrind and -m32
488026 Use of `sizeof` instead of `strlen
488379 --track-fds=yes errors that cannot be suppressed with --xml-file=
488441 Add tests for --track-fds=yes --xml=yes and fd suppression tests
489040 massif trace change to show the location increasing the stack
489088 Valgrind throws unhandled instruction bytes: 0xC5 0x79 0xD6 0xE0 0xC5
489338 arm64: Instruction fcvtas should round 322.5 to 323, but result is 322.
489676 vgdb handle EINTR and EAGAIN more consistently
490651 Stop using -flto-partition=one
491394 (vgModuleLocal_addDiCfSI): Assertion 'di->fsm.have_rx_map &&
di->fsm.rw_map_count' failed
492210 False positive on x86/amd64 with ZF taken directly from addition
492214 statx(fd, NULL, AT_EMPTY_PATH) is supported since Linux 6.11
but not supported in valgrind
492422 Please support DRM_IOCTL_SYNCOBJ_HANDLE_TO_FD
492663 Valgrind ignores debug info for some binaries
493418 Add bad fd usage errors for --track-fds in ML_(fd_allowed)
493454 Missing FUSE_COMPATIBLE_MAY_BLOCK markers
493507 direct readlink syscall from PRE handler is incompatible with
FUSE_COMPATIBLE_MAY_BLOCK
493959 s390x: Fix regtest failure for none/tests/s390x/op00
493970 s390x: Store/restore FPC upon helper call causes slowdown
494252 s390x: incorrect disassembly for LOCHI and friends
494960 Fixes and tweaks for gsl19test
495278 PowerPC instruction dcbf should allow the L field values of 4, 6 on
ISA 3.0 and earlier, just ignore the value
495469 aligned_alloc and posix_memalign missing MALLOC_TRACE with returned
pointer
495470 s390x: 3.24.0.RC1 missing file and regtest failure
n-i-bz Improve messages for sigaltstack errors, use specific
stack_t member names
PR: 282365
Reported by: [email protected]
a2c8708 |
08:43 Robert Clausecker (fuz)
net-mgmt/rate: fix build on 15-CURRENT
- link with -lutil to grab ftime() on 15-CURRENT. This is harmless on
older FreeBSD
- while we are at it, install binary using INSTALL_PROGRAM so it is
stripped
Approved by: portmgr (build fix blanket)
MFH: 2024Q4
76b0011 |
08:43 Robert Clausecker (fuz)
- finance/ticker 4.7.1
Terminal stock ticker with live updates and position tracking
finance/ticker: update to 4.7.0
- switch to GO_MODULE now that upstream has sorted out the module
path naming
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/achannarasappa/ticker/releases/tag/v4.7.0
Changelog: https://github.com/achannarasappa/ticker/releases/tag/v4.7.1
4b0b3a5 |
08:42 Robert Clausecker (fuz)
- filesystems/ods2 1.3_1
Utility for manipulating ODS-2 filesystems
- sysutils/ods2 1.3_1
Utility for manipulating ODS-2 filesystems
- MOVED
- filesystems/Makefile
sysutils/ods2: move to filesystems/ods2
- tool manipulates VMS file systems
- add timestamp to distinfo to satisfy post-receive hook
Approved by: portmgr (infrastructure blanket)
29d06d48
08:41 Robert Clausecker (fuz)
sysutils/ods2: unbreak fetch, fix build on 15-CURRENT, define license
- turn static REINPLACE_CMD into patch file
- define LICENSE
- host distfile that has gone away locally (port seems import enough
to warrant keeping it)
- obey CC
- link with -lutil to get ftime() on 15-CURRENT, this is harmless on
older versions of FreeBSD
Approved by: portmgr (build fix, infrastructure blanket)
MFH: 2024Q4
3a14c65 |
08:41 Robert Clausecker (fuz)
astro/openuniverse: fix build on FreeBSD 15-CURRENT
ftime() is now provided by libutil; link -lutil in addition to -lcompat
to get it; this is harmless on older FreeBSD.
While we are at it, define LICENSE and fix USE_GL stage-qa warnings.
MFH: 2024Q4
c3dde4e |
08:41 Robert Clausecker (fuz) | | | | | |